> >SBI PMU extension allows KVM guests to configure/start/stop/query about
> >the PMU counters in virtualized enviornment as well.
> >
> >In order to allow that, KVM implements the entire SBI PMU extension.

This is an invalid warning as vcpu_sbi_ext_pmu is used as an extern variable in
arch/riscv/kvm/vcpu_sbi.c. That's how every sbi extension code defines the
kvm_vcpu_sbi_extension in its own respective file.
